Since it contravenes TMDb content guidelines to create collections for stage companies (plays) that regularly produce videos of their productions*, can there be some type of standard naming convention employed; at least for everything by common Stage Company productions that is consistent across their own releases?

For example, Stratford Festival has been producing such videos since 1984, but the naming of such videos is inconsistent. I.E.:

  • Play Title - Stratford Festival of Canada
  • Play Title (Stratford Festival)
  • Stratford Festival: Play Title

and very likely some with no such identification whatsoever.

Or should such productions instead be converted to "series" with each "season" representing everything during a stage production year?

Thank you for your consideration.

*as evidenced by recent DM from TMDb Support dated 20-07-08, regarding deletion of "National Theatre Live Collection"

Hi, while I can see how adding the festival name as part of the title can be very useful, are those really part of the original titles? What is a typical on screen title, for example? Or how are they listed on their website?

Or should such productions instead be converted to "series" with each "season" representing everything during a stage production year?

No, these belong in the movie section set to video:true.

Edit: I should also add that users are often mixing up the stage director with the director (of the broadcast).
